What is the story behind the name Charlotte?
The name Charlotte is a girl’s name of French origin meaning “free man”. Charlotte is the feminine form of the male given name Charles. It derived from Charlot, a French diminutive of Charles meaning “little Charles,” and the name of Charlemagne’s son in French literature and legend.

What does the name Mia mean?
Mia is believed to originally stem from the ancient Egyptian word Mr, which means beloved. The name has since come to be linked to the Italian word mia, meaning mine, and is also recognized as a derivation from the Slavic word Mila, meaning dear or darling.

What does the Namejack mean?
God is Gracious
The name Jack is a derivative of John, which originated in medieval England. The name went from John to Johnkin to Jankin to Jackin to, you guessed it, Jack.Gender: Jack is traditionally the masculine form of the name and means “God is Gracious.” However, both Jack and Jac are considered gender-neutral.

What is the Spanish word for Charlotte?
From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ia. Carlota is a Portuguese and Spanish given name, equivalent to Charlotte in English.
Is there a saint Charlotte?
Saint Charlotte was a Carmelite nun who was executed along with others during the French Revolution.

Is Mia a biblical name?
Mia is a diminutive of different names, including Amelia, Emilia, Amalia, but most likely Maria.Maria is a name used in the New Testament, ultimately derived from the Hebrew name Miryam. There are several possible meanings of Miryam, some of them being: “lots of bitterness”, “wished for child”, “bitter”, “rebellious”.
Does Mia mean bitter?
Mia means ‘my’, ‘mine’, or ‘bitter’. It is usually derived from the name Maria and its variants (Miriam, Maryam, Mary), but it is reportedly also used as a hypocoristic of names such as Amalia, Amelia, Emilia, Emily, Salome (Solomia) or Maya.
